X96 chinese rom and the GAPPS problem, is it possible to make it work?

I am still a green beginner when it comes to making a custom firmware but I basically only do it for my personal needs and offer the result for everyone.
However, there is one thing really nagging me ith the X96 and that is to get updated GAPPS to work properly and with all Google apps.
The basics like Playstore, Framework and Play Services and managed to get going but only by disabling some "features" in the firmware and with the box showing up as uncertified.
Real problem is to get the TV GAPPS working at all.
No matter how I spoof the build.prop, disable services and manully add permissions, the TV Gapps claim be on an unsupported device and demand dowgrade / removal of updates.
For a chinese phone I would simply flash an internation rom and be done with it but not so much on a chinese TV box
What I tried so far for the TV GAPPS:
Using custom roms claiming to work for several boxes including the X96.
Here the rom either fails to boot unless I modify it or if it boots then nothing, and I mean nothing all works.
Funny enough that some user of a X96 say they have no problem with the same rom...
Next was to clean the original firmware from all Google related apps, services, scripts and libraries, then manually installing the TV GAPPS.
For this I always get the error that the device is not compatible.
Even if in the build.prop a Mibox or Nvidia Shield is spoofed together with ro.build.characteristics=tv.
Last but not least the Open GAPPS TV version.
Flashing works just fine and with no errors, on a cleaned and on a standard rom.
After that it is all over.
Setup Wizard crashes, if disabled or removed the other Google apps and services crash, usually starting with the TV Wizard and TV Customisation.
TV Playstore again claims the device is not compatible in the rare case it does start otherwise I get an error that the Play services are missing on the device.
But of course all is installed completely....
What I would love to know is how and where these chinese roms disable the Google compatibility.
Here is what I think I found so far that does not make much sense to me:
The supplied Playstore is signed with different key than anything else on the system partition.
The same version number from APKMIRROR fails to install or work if replaced in the rom.
I tried signing with the Amlogic platform, test and release keys to no avail.
Both by zip aligning before or after the signing.
Other apps I sign with these keys perform just fine.
Just to be able to use the Open GAPPS through TWRP I had to disable a PPoE apk that runs presistent - with that active no open Gapps pack works (claiming device is incompatible or simply crashing).
There are a bunch of additional certificates installed in the ETC folder than when removed or renamed cause the system to fail - I had no time so far to do a one on one check to figure out for what each cert might be used.
When comparing fstabs with other roms it seems the X96 has lot more than what would be required but my understanding of all that is still too limited.
I guess the big question is:
Does anyone know what is causing all these problems in chinese roms and how to fix it without flashing a firmware for different TV box?
Update:
On my X96 I am slowly making progress with the GAPPS.
Found a PPPoE app and service that are set to run persistent.
According to some funny Google translations from chinese websites using persistent services to block genuine Google stuff is one available option.
By disabling the PPPoE persistent stuff and only leaving the normal PPPoE stuff active Ethernet and WiFi still work fine but now the Open Gapps installation actually works.
Well, not fully but at least the Nano package works flawless.
With that it is not problem to install the missing Google apps through the Playstore, including Google TV and Music.
Sync and backup works fine too.
Only downside is that without spoofing the device will be listed as uncertified - but all updates and installs so far went with no problems.
But even the Google NOW and Pixel launchers can be installed and used if someone likes them.
Different story though for the TV Gapps, wether modified or not.
Build.prop mods and fakes, using the latest and older versions of the playservices and framework - they all fail.
I managed a few times to find combinations that at least booted into the leanback launcher and that were usable except for the Google stuff but it was no fun.
No matter how I try to spoof or change the installation the setup wizard never works, which indicates the services fail to work.
In the rare case where I get somewhere I am told that I should unistall all updates as this version of Plastore or services is not compatible.
Will do some more digging on services and apps that should not be there but the chinese really like to disguise things they don't want anyone to see LOL

Hi,
I used to have the same problem, for *some* APKs even on 8.0. What i did (not sure what caused the problem, actually) was:
1) Enable unknown sources via dev. menu
2) Disable the Play Protect and built-in antivirus(es), e.g. AVG
3) Disable app checking from Google options (this might be tricky, because the app itself didn't show me this option, bit it came up eventually, don't remember how, i think when you try to install the .apk via ES or some other file explorer.)
Now it gives me the "App not installed" or "Unable to install" only when i try to update an app that was not originally installed from the Play Store, but (for example Aptoide or other Black Market store) it can be remedied by simply uninstalling the old app and install the new one.
Hope this helps. Good luck!

T95 H616 fixing Google Play. How do I do this?

THIS IS A T95 H616 DUAL BAND MODEL.
As is obvious by now, this box is known for Google Play issues. My box did come with regular Google Play Store as opposed to the TV version but it down right refuses to update to the latest version and if I try to install via APK I always get 'App not installed'. Since the device does have ROOT out of the box I took the opportunity to make things a bit more useable in that department by installing Magisk, and I have been able to manually update the Play Store to the latest version and it works just fine but I don't want to have to do it this way every time. The box can live with the Play Store being completely uninstalled using this method and I thought I'd try installing from scratch. Nope. It still gives me 'App not installed'. I've even tried manually creating the folders and moving the APK to /data/app/, setting the relevant permissions and ownership but still this was a no-go as when I restarted the device every change I'd made in there had been cleared. What else can I try?
android 10 doesn't let you modify the system partition period. the only ways to modify it are via magisk modules, flashing the whole rom with your mods included or maybe via TWRP (which we don't have).
I've noticed on this box that it doesn't like having it's system apps removed either, others have said the changes won't stick or you'll get a bootloop. freezing system apps does work however, I was able to freeze the ATV YouTube and install Vanced.
on the play store front I've not had too many problems other than paid apps not showing as paid for about 24 hours after a factory reset. I haven't checked what version it was on or whether it was latest, I'll go and look now.
